EHC Program Update: Draft Key Questions on Trauma Informed Care Available for Comment

AHRQ Effective Health Care

Opportunity to Comment on Draft Key Questions

We encourage the public to participate in the development of our research projects. Comments can be submitted for: 

Trauma Informed Care
Available for comment until May 19, 2023

The purpose of this review is to examine the evidence of Trauma Informed Care (TIC) frameworks, models, and components to establish the state of the science related to the effectiveness of TIC on health and healthcare outcomes and harms. The review will also describe how TIC has been defined and approached in practice and explore the commonality of components.

 

About us: AHRQ's Effective Health Care Program is committed to providing the best available evidence on the outcomes, benefits and harms, and appropriateness of drugs, devices, and health care services and by helping health care professionals, patients, policymakers, and health care systems make informed health care decisions. The program partners with research centers, academic institutions, health professional societies, consumer organizations, and other stakeholders to conduct research, evidence synthesis, evidence translation, dissemination, and implementation of research findings.
